Epidemiologic studies have demonstrated that at least 6% of filled prescriptions for either acetaminophen alone or acetaminophen in combination with opioids exceeded 4000 mg per day of acetaminophen, which is a cause for real concern.3,5,6 Further epidemiologic studies have demonstrated that there is a true lack of knowledge regarding the harmful potential of APAP
